Situated on the charming C. dos 28 street in Acacias, Benito Juárez, Gebel Café offers a delightful culinary experience that perfectly blends the casual comfort of a coffee shop with the satisfying heartiness of a breakfast restaurant and cafeteria. This inviting café embraces a vibrant yet cozy atmosphere, enhanced by its scenic terrace that overlooks a lush park—an ideal setting for both social gatherings and quiet escapes.
Gebel Café’s menu is a celebration of rich flavors and quality ingredients, with a tempting array of pizzas and pastas that showcase their dedication to fresh, handcrafted dishes. Imagine savoring an 8-slice Pizza de Pastor, layered with tender carne al pastor, sweet pineapple, crunchy purple onion, and fresh cilantro, or indulging in a comforting Pasta Ragú that features a rich sirloin tomato sauce, kissed with olive oil and topped with fragrant oregano and freshly grated parmesan. For those craving creamy indulgence, the Pasta Alfredo promises a luscious, velvety sauce that clings to your pasta of choice.
The café doesn’t stop there. Their specialties elevate the dining experience further—particularly the Pechuga a la Parmesana, where a perfectly breaded chicken breast is smothered in marinara and mozzarella, served alongside buttery spaghetti al burro, melding textures and flavors that deliver pure comfort. Another highlight is the Baguette Gebel, packed with succulent roast beef, a zesty touch of mustard, and molten provolone cheese, paired with crispy potato chips and a robust jus — a handheld feast that’s both satisfying and sophisticated.
Gebel Café’s atmosphere invites you to linger. Multiple visitors praise its cozy, unpretentious charm, especially the terrace overlooking the park, which provides a serene backdrop for your meal. Many recommend grabbing a seat outside to soak up the fresh air and vibrant surroundings, especially during their popular Thursday jazz nights that blend delightful live music with unforgettable cuisine.
Guests consistently highlight the warm, attentive service that complements the rich sensory experience—from the aroma of freshly brewed coffee to the enticing sight of their signature carrot cake, a must-try indulgence that punctuates any visit perfectly. Whether you’re stopping by for a quick coffee and tiramisu or settling in for a hearty breakfast, Gebel Café warmly welcomes you to savor the flavors of Mexico City away from the more hectic neighborhoods.
